一种服务器风扇安装方向的识别方法和装置与流程

文档序号:23699216发布日期:2021-01-23 11:22阅读:240来源:国知局
一种服务器风扇安装方向的识别方法和装置与流程

[0001]
本发明涉及服务器生产安装技术领域,更具体地,特别是指一种服务器风扇安装方向的识别方法和装置。


背景技术:

[0002]
服务器生产过程中,需要按照服务器的设计安装多个散热风扇,有些风扇为对称设计,正反都能安装,且能正常运转;但是风扇虽然能运转,安装方向出错的风扇与其他风扇的风向会不一致,影响服务器散热,导致功能的不稳定。


技术实现要素:

[0003]
有鉴于此,本发明实施例的目的在于提供一种在线识别服务器风扇安装方向的方法和装置。
[0004]
基于上述目的,本发明一方面提供了一种服务器风扇安装方向的识别方法,该方法包括:
[0005]
响应于感应到服务器的到位信号,将到位信号发送至控制单元,控制单元根据到位信号控制顶升机构将服务器移动至预设区域;
[0006]
响应于通过控制单元判断服务器移动至预设区域,发送准备完成信号至读码器;
[0007]
响应于读码器接受到准备完成信号,获取服务器的sn码的内容信息;
[0008]
根据内容信息获取服务器的风扇安装信息;
[0009]
通过风扇安装信息识别风扇的风向标识,根据获取的服务器的风扇安装区域的图像数据以及风向标识获取风扇的安装方向。
[0010]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0011]
响应于获取到服务器的sn码,从远程服务器获取服务器的机器型号、风扇型号、所需安装的风扇数量以及机器型号与风扇型号匹配的视觉方案。
[0012]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0013]
通过控制单元根据生产线的状态信息控制相机、相机光源和条码读码器的配置以获取服务器的sn码以及获取服务器的风扇安装区域的图像数据。
[0014]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0015]
将感应器固定在生产线的特定位置,通过感应器感应生产线上的风扇安装区域是否到位,并将到位信号发送至控制单元。
[0016]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0017]
将顶升机构固定在支架正对的生产线的对应区域,将顶升机构连接至控制单元,响应于控制单元接收到到位信号,根据到位信号通过控制顶升机构将服务器移动至预设区域。
[0018]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0019]
通过工装板承载服务器在生产线的流动面上沿着流动方向移动。
[0020]
在本发明的服务器风扇安装方向的识别方法的一些实施方式中,方法还包括:
[0021]
将相机光源安装在支架上,通过相机光源为相机对服务器的拍照进行补光,光源连接至控制单元,通过控制单元控制相机光源的开启或关闭。
[0022]
本发明实施例的另一方面,还提供了一种服务器风扇安装方向的识别装置,该装置包括:
[0023]
支架,支架固定于生产线的上方;
[0024]
相机,相机固定在支架上,相机的镜头面向生产线以获取生产线上服务器的风扇安装区域的图像数据;
[0025]
条码读码器,条码读码器固定在支架上,以获取生产线上的服务器的sn码;
[0026]
控制单元,控制单元连接至相机和条码读码器,配置为获取相机拍摄的图像数据和条码读码器获取的sn码的内容信息,进一步通过内容信息获取服务器的风扇安装信息,并通过图像数据根据风扇安装信息识别服务器的风扇的安装方向。
[0027]
在本发明的服务器风扇安装方向的识别装置的一些实施方式中,控制单元还包括:
[0028]
视觉控制器,视觉控制器连接至相机、相机光源和条码读码器;
[0029]
plc,plc连接至视觉控制器,以控制视觉控制器;
[0030]
远程服务器,远程服务器连接至视觉控制器,从视觉控制器获取相机拍摄的图像数据和条码读码器读取的sn码,并通过sn码获取服务器的风扇安装信息,通过图像数据根据安装信息为服务器识别风扇的方向。
[0031]
在本发明的服务器风扇安装方向的识别装置的一些实施方式中,装置还包括:
[0032]
主窗体,主窗体显示从控制单元获取的图像数据和处理数据。
[0033]
本发明至少具有以下有益技术效果:可以解决服务器生产过程中风扇装反以及兼容多服务器机型和多风扇型号的识别问题。
附图说明
[0034]
为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的实施例。
[0035]
图1示出了根据本发明的服务器风扇安装方向的识别方法的实施例的示意性框图;
[0036]
图2示出了根据本发明的服务器风扇安装方向的识别方法的实施例的结构图;
[0037]
图3示出了根据本发明的服务器风扇安装方向的识别装置的实施例的结构图;
[0038]
图4示出了根据本发明的服务器风扇安装方向的识别装置的实施例的生产线的局部俯视结构图;
[0039]
图5示出了根据本发明的服务器风扇安装方向的识别装置的实施例的风扇区域的图像;
[0040]
图6示出了根据本发明的服务器风扇安装方向的识别装置的实施例的风扇区域的需要处理的风扇范围标定图像;
[0041]
图7示出了根据本发明的服务器风扇安装方向的识别装置的实施例的需要处理的服务器范围标定图像;
[0042]
图8示出了根据本发明的服务器风扇安装方向的识别装置的实施例的风扇的风向标识标定图像。
具体实施方式
[0043]
为使本发明的目的、技术方案和优点更加清楚明白,以下结合具体实施例,并参照附图,对本发明实施例进一步详细说明。
[0044]
需要说明的是,本发明实施例中所有使用“第一”和“第二”的表述均是为了区分两个相同名称非相同的实体或者非相同的参量,可见“第一”和“第二”仅为了表述的方便,不应理解为对本发明实施例的限定,后续实施例对此不再一一说明。
[0045]
基于上述目的,本发明实施例的第一个方面,提出了一种服务器风扇安装方向的识别方法的实施例。图1示出了根据本发明的服务器风扇安装方向的识别方法的实施例的示意性框图,如图1所示的实施例中,该方法至少包括如下步骤:
[0046]
s100、响应于感应到服务器的到位信号,将到位信号发送至控制单元,控制单元根据到位信号控制顶升机构将服务器移动至预设区域;
[0047]
s200、响应于通过控制单元判断服务器移动至预设区域,发送准备完成信号至读码器;
[0048]
s300、响应于读码器接受到准备完成信号,获取服务器的sn码的内容信息;
[0049]
s400、根据内容信息获取服务器的风扇安装信息;
[0050]
s500、通过风扇安装信息识别风扇的风向标识,根据获取的服务器的风扇安装区域的图像数据以及风向标识获取风扇的安装方向。
[0051]
在本发明的一些实施例中,图3示出的是根据本发明的服务器风扇安装方向的识别装置的实施例的结构图;图4示出的是根据本发明的服务器风扇安装方向的识别装置的实施例的生产线的局部俯视结构图,如图3和图4所示的实施例中,控制单元包括视觉控制器8、远程服务器以及plc(programmable logic controller,可编程逻辑控制器),因此装置部分包括相机1,相机光源2,条码读码器3,服务器4,支架5,顶升机构6,工装板7,视觉控制器8,感应器9,生产线10,远程服务器,plc组成。相机1、相机光源2、条码读码器3通过固定支架5固定于生产线10,相机1的视野范围包含服务器4中风扇部分。视觉控制器8,感应器9,顶升机构6固定于生产线10上。服务器4放置于工装板7在生产线10上流动。相机1、相机光源2、条码读码器3连接到视觉控制器8,视觉控制器8通过网络与plc和远程服务器连接。感应器8与顶升机构6信号接入plc。当服务器4配合工装板7在生产线10上流动到感应器9时,plc检测到物料(即服务器4配合工装板7)的到位信号后,将顶升机构6升起,起到将服务器精确定位的作用。当顶升机构6的定位完成后,发出准备完成信号。检测到plc准备完成信号后,启动条码读码器3,条码读码器3获取服务器4的sn码的内容信息。从远程服务器中获取安装信息,该安装信息包括对应的sn对应的机型、需要安装的风扇pn、需要安装的风扇数量、对应的机型和需要安装的风扇pn所匹配的视觉方案。之后,准备开始拍照,启动相机光源2,然后启动相机1,图5示出的是根据本发明的服务器风扇安装方向的识别装置的实施例的风扇区域的图像,如图5所示,获取到服务器4的风扇区域的图像。图6示出的是根据本发明的服
务器风扇安装方向的识别装置的实施例的风扇区域的需要处理的风扇范围标定图像;图7示出的是根据本发明的服务器风扇安装方向的识别装置的实施例的需要处理的服务器范围标定图像,如图6和图7所示,按照从远程服务器获取的视觉处理方案先快速处理从相机1获取的视觉图像,从而初步确定需要处理的范围,提高运行效率。当确定具体识别区域后,按照视觉方案精确的处理风扇的标识特征,进行具体识别,图8示出的是根据本发明的服务器风扇安装方向的识别装置的实施例的风扇的风向标识标定图像,如图8所示,按照风扇的风向标识进行识别。处理完成最终的图像后,将图像数据和处理图像数据显示在主窗体上,然后将识别到的最终正确风扇安装数量与从远程服务器中获取的安装信息中的需要安装的风扇数量进行判断,如果数量一致,则与plc通讯,通过pl控制顶升机构6落下,服务器4流向下一个生产工序;如果数量不一致,会报警提示,将机器留在原地,等待处理。本发明可以根据机型和风扇pn自动调用不同的运行规则,可以兼容不同型号服务器配合各种风扇的使用需求。
[0052]
在本发明的一些实施例中,图2示出的是根据本发明的服务器风扇安装方向的识别方法的实施例的结构图,如图2所示的实施例中,软件部分包含主窗体,sn输入模块,机型、风扇pn(part number,零件号,即风扇型号)风扇数量判断模块、风扇数量判断程序模块,图像显示模块,模板设置模块,机型、风扇pn、视觉方案设置模块,光源控制模块,条码读码器控制模块,plc通讯模块。其中,sn输入模块的主要作用是显示条码读码器3获取的内容;机型、风扇pn、风扇数量判断模块的主要作用是当sn输入模块获取到服务器4的机器sn(serial number,序列号)后,从控制单元中的远程服务器获取机器型号、风扇pn和应该安装的风扇数量等信息。图像处理模块主要是按照从远程服务器获取的视觉方案处理相机1获取的图像数据并显示在主窗体上。软件连接生产线控制plc,可以实时获取plc各点位信息,当获取到相机下方有机器等待识别时,软件启动条码读码器读码,以识别机器的sn码,sn码是服务器的唯一识别码。模板设置模块以及机型、风扇pn、视觉方案设置模块的主要作用是在后台维护服务器机型对应的不同风扇的各种对应的图像处理方案。光源控制模块的主要作用是当需要拍照时提前开启相机光源2从而起到补光作用,当拍照完成后,自动关闭相机光源2。条码读码器控制模块以及plc通讯模块的作用是从plc中获取生产线10的状态,以配合整个系统使用。
[0053]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0054]
响应于获取到服务器的sn码,从远程服务器获取服务器的机器型号、风扇型号、所需安装的风扇数量以及机器型号与风扇型号匹配的视觉方案。
[0055]
在本发明的一些实施例中,sn输入模块的主要作用是显示条码读码器3获取的内容;机型、风扇pn、风扇数量判断模块的主要作用是当sn输入模块获取到服务器4的机器sn(serial number,序列号)后,从控制单元中的远程服务器获取机器型号、风扇pn和应该安装的风扇数量等信息。
[0056]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0057]
通过控制单元根据生产线的状态信息控制相机、相机光源和条码读码器的配置以获取服务器的sn码以及获取服务器的风扇安装区域的图像数据。
[0058]
在本发明的一些实施例中,软件连接生产线控制控制单元中的plc,可以实时获取plc各点位信息,当获取到相机下方有机器等待识别时,软件启动条码读码器读码,以识别
机器的sn码,sn码是服务器的唯一识别码。模板设置模块以及机型、风扇pn、视觉方案设置模块的主要作用是在后台维护服务器机型对应的不同风扇的各种对应的图像处理方案。光源控制模块的主要作用是当需要拍照时提前开启相机光源2从而起到补光作用,当拍照完成后,自动关闭相机光源2。
[0059]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0060]
将感应器固定在生产线的特定位置,通过感应器感应生产线上的风扇安装区域是否到位,并将到位信号发送至控制单元。
[0061]
在本发明的一些实施例中,如图3和图4所示,感应器9的信号接入至plc。当服务器4配合工装板7在生产线10上流动到感应器9时,即感应器9检测到生产线10上出现到位信号后,将到位信号发送至控制单元中的plc,plc即可检测到物料的到位信号。
[0062]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0063]
将顶升机构固定在支架正对的生产线的对应区域,将顶升机构连接至控制单元,响应于控制单元接收到到位信号,根据到位信号通过控制顶升机构将服务器移动至预设区域。
[0064]
在本发明的一些实施例中,如图3所示,顶升机构6的信号接入至plc。plc检测到物料的到位信号后,控制顶升机构6升起到预设区域,起到精确定位的作用。
[0065]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0066]
通过工装板承载服务器在生产线的流动面上沿着流动方向移动。
[0067]
在本发明的一些实施例中,如图3和图4所示,服务器4放置于工装板7上,通过工装板7承载着服务器4在生产线10上流动。
[0068]
根据本发明的服务器风扇安装方向的识别方法的一些实施方式,方法还包括:
[0069]
将相机光源安装在支架上,通过相机光源为相机对服务器的拍照进行补光,光源连接至控制单元,通过控制单元控制相机光源的开启或关闭。
[0070]
在本发明的一些实施例中,如图3所示,工业相机1、相机光源2、条码读码器3连接到控制单元中的视觉控制器8,主要作用是当需要拍照时,通过控制单元控制提前开启相机光源2从而起到补光作用,当拍照完成后,关闭相机光源2。
[0071]
本发明实施例的另一方面,提出了一种服务器风扇安装方向的识别装置的实施例。该装置包括:
[0072]
支架,支架固定于生产线的上方;
[0073]
相机,相机固定在支架上,相机的镜头面向生产线以获取生产线上服务器的风扇安装区域的图像数据;
[0074]
条码读码器,条码读码器固定在支架上,以获取生产线上的服务器的sn码;
[0075]
控制单元,控制单元连接至相机和条码读码器,配置为获取相机拍摄的图像数据和条码读码器获取的sn码的内容信息,进一步通过内容信息获取服务器的风扇安装信息,并通过图像数据根据风扇安装信息识别服务器的风扇的安装方向。
[0076]
根据本发明的服务器风扇安装方向的识别装置的一些实施方式,控制单元还包括:
[0077]
视觉控制器,视觉控制器连接至相机、相机光源和条码读码器;
[0078]
plc,plc连接至视觉控制器,以控制视觉控制器;
[0079]
远程服务器,远程服务器连接至视觉控制器,从视觉控制器获取相机拍摄的图像数据和条码读码器读取的sn码,并通过sn码获取服务器的风扇安装信息,通过图像数据根据安装信息为服务器识别风扇的方向。
[0080]
根据本发明的服务器风扇安装方向的识别装置的一些实施方式,装置还包括:
[0081]
主窗体,主窗体显示从控制单元获取的图像数据和处理数据。
[0082]
同样地,本领域技术人员应当理解,以上针对根据本发明的服务器风扇安装方向的识别方法阐述的所有实施方式、特征和优势同样地适用于根据本发明的装置。为了本公开的简洁起见,在此不再重复阐述。
[0083]
应当理解的是,在本文中使用的,除非上下文清楚地支持例外情况,单数形式“一个”旨在也包括复数形式。还应当理解的是,在本文中使用的“和/或”是指包括一个或者一个以上相关联地列出的项目的任意和所有可能组合。
[0084]
上述本发明实施例公开实施例序号仅仅为了描述,不代表实施例的优劣。
[0085]
所属领域的普通技术人员应当理解:以上任何实施例的讨论仅为示例性的,并非旨在暗示本发明实施例公开的范围(包括权利要求)被限于这些例子;在本发明实施例的思路下,以上实施例或者不同实施例中的技术特征之间也可以进行组合,并存在如上的本发明实施例的不同方面的许多其它变化,为了简明它们没有在细节中提供。因此,凡在本发明实施例的精神和原则之内,所做的任何省略、修改、等同替换、改进等,均应包含在本发明实施例的保护范围之内。
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1